  • Giro d’Italia 2023’s Team Bikes and Riders

    Giro d’Italia 2023’s Team Bikes and Riders

    This page is the ultimate guide about Giro d’Italia 2023’s Team Bikes and Riders.

    The Italian Grand Tour starts on May 6th and ends on May 28th, 2023.
    In a nutshell, the 106th edition of the Giro d’Italia is 3,489km long, 51,400m cumulated altitude gain, and an average of 166km race per day, for three weeks.

  • Andrea Piccolo’s 2023 Bike Size

    Andrea Piccolo’s 2023 Bike Size

    Today I am writing about Andrea Piccolo’s 2023 Bike Size.
    In case you don’t know who is Andrea Piccolo, he is one of those super-talented young riders joining the pro peloton.

    Andrea joined the team EF Education-EasyPost on August 2022 with a contract up to 2024 included.
    As soon as the young Italian rider joined the World Tour’s team, Andrea started racing on some end-of-the-season classics.

    Already a Great Rider

    He finished 5th on the Maryland Cycling Classic, 3rd on the Coppa Agostini – Giro Del Brianze, 11th on Il Lombardia, and 2nd on the Japan Cup Cycle Road Race.
    It looks like the Team EF Education-EasyPost has picked up a promising rider.
